Maybach Typ Zeppelin Doppel-Sechs 7 Liter (DS 7) Cabriolet 7.0 V12

Maybach Typ Zeppelin Doppel-Sechs 7 Liter (DS 7) Cabriolet · 1930 - 1933 · Petrol

The Maybach Typ Zeppelin Doppel-Sechs 7 Liter (DS 7) Cabriolet 7.0 V12 produces 150 hp and — Nm. Stated combined consumption is 26.1 l/100 km, equal to 622 g CO2 per km.
